The Neurosurgery Surgical 6¼″ Brun Spratt Curette – Size 2 is a high-performance surgical instrument developed to provide superior precision during bone curettage, tissue debridement, and the removal of pathological bone and soft tissue. Featuring an overall length of 6¼ inches and a Size 2 curette, this instrument offers an ideal combination of control, stability, and efficiency, making it an essential tool for neurosurgical, orthopedic, spinal, and trauma procedures.
Manufactured from premium medical-grade stainless steel, the Brun Spratt Curette – Size 2 is designed to withstand the rigorous demands of modern surgical environments. Its corrosion-resistant stainless steel construction protects against rust, pitting, staining, and repeated sterilization, ensuring exceptional durability and reliable long-term clinical performance. Precision machining produces a uniformly shaped curette tip with finely finished edges, allowing surgeons to remove bone fragments, granulation tissue, fibrous tissue, and other pathological material with excellent accuracy while preserving healthy surrounding structures.
The Size 2 curette features a larger working end than the Size 1 model, providing increased efficiency for bone preparation and tissue removal while maintaining excellent tactile feedback. The carefully engineered curette cup allows controlled scraping of bone surfaces and effective debridement in both confined and moderately sized operative fields. Its design supports accurate removal of diseased tissue while minimizing unnecessary trauma to adjacent anatomical structures.
With its 6¼-inch overall length, the instrument provides an excellent balance between reach and maneuverability.
